Output 150ef1cfc9118d4bc31883c5320000b4a4105b21f2c0536036468a1f87a8f7d3:0

value
10242839984538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a81de2621deafe07074983527791bf12ff9952a OP_EQUALVERIFY OP_CHECKSIG
address
PhdwLnaBSXEff4qkaAX46jFSuYUpAEHYd8
transaction
150ef1cfc9118d4bc31883c5320000b4a4105b21f2c0536036468a1f87a8f7d3